Understanding Parrot Species

Parrots come in numerous species, each with unique attributes. The most typically kept pet parrots include:

  1. Budgerigar (Budgie)
  2. African Grey
  3. Amazon Parrot
  4. Cockatoo
  5. Macaw

Table 1: Comparison of Common Parrot Species

Parrot SpeciesTypical LifespanSize (inches)Cost (GBP)Social NeedsSound LevelTrainability
Budgerigar5-10 years7-8₤ 15-₤ 100ModerateLowHigh
African Grey Parrot Kaufen Grey40-60 years12-14₤ 800-₤ 3,000HighModerateExtremely High
Amazon Parrot25-50 years10-15₤ 400-₤ 2,000HighHighHigh
Cockatoo40-60 years12-24₤ 1,000-₤ 3,500Very HighVery HighHigh
Macaw30-50 years20-40₤ 1,500-₤ 3,500Really HighVery HighModerate

Elements to Consider When Buying a Parrot

  1. Cost of Purchase

    • While preliminary expenses are essential, potential parrot owners ought to also think about ongoing expenditures, including food, veterinary care, and toys.
  2. Area Requirements

    • Parrots require ample space to stroll, extend their wings, and play.
  3. Socialization Needs

    • Many parrots need significant interaction with their human caretakers. Comprehending the social needs particular to each types is vital.
  4. Noise Level

    • Some parrots are loud and can be disruptive. This factor is especially important for apartment occupants.
  5. Lifespan

    • The long life expectancy of numerous parrots implies a long-term dedication. Potential owners should examine their capability to offer lifelong care.
  6. Trainability

    • Some types are much easier to train than others. This element may impact how well the parrot engages with its owner and the family.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What should I try to find in a trustworthy breeder?

Choose a breeder with an excellent credibility who is transparent about health records, breeding practices, and supplies a comfortable environment for Buy a parrot the birds.

2. How do I understand if a parrot is healthy?

Observe the bird's plumes (they must be smooth and tidy), eyes (bright and clear), and beak (smooth without cracks). A healthy parrot is likewise active and alert.

3. How much time do parrots need daily?

A lot of parrots need a number of hours of social interaction every day, along with time to exercise outside their cages.

4. Are parrots suitable for novice pet owners?

It depends upon the types. Smaller parrots like budgies are frequently much better for beginners than bigger breeds like cockatoos or macaws.

5. What type of diet do parrots require?

A well-balanced diet plan consists of high-quality pellets, fresh fruits, veggies, seeds, and nuts. Some types have particular dietary requirements.
